Item 1.01. Entry into a Material Definitive Agreement.

On February 18, 2005, Fairchild Semiconductor International, Inc. accelerated the vesting of certain unvested and "out-of-the-money" stock options outstanding under the company’s stock plans that have exercise prices per share of $19.50 or higher. Options to purchase approximately 6 million shares of the company’s common stock became exercisable immediately. Options held by non-employee directors were not included in the vesting acceleration. In addition, in order to prevent unintended personal benefits to executive officers, restrictions will be imposed on any shares received through the exercise of accelerated options held by those individuals. Those restrictions will prevent the sale of any shares received from the exercise of an accelerated option prior to the earlier of the original vesting date of the option or the individual’s termination of employment.

Under the recently revised Financial Accounting Standards Board Statement No. 123, "Share-Based Payment," the company will apply the expense recognition provisions relating to stock options beginning in the third quarter of 2005. As a result of the acceleration, the company expects to reduce the stock option expense it otherwise would be required to record by approximately $10 million in 2005, $12 million in 2006, $4 million in 2007 and $1 million in 2008 on a pre-tax basis.
